McLaren reveal extent of Piastri's damage during F1 Chinese GP

McLaren Formula 1 boss Andrea Stella has revealed the damage Oscar Piastri nursed on his car from contact under the Safety Car in China was worth 'four-tenths'. Piastri, who had qualified inside the top five, trailed home in a distant eighth place in the race, over 42 seconds behind team-mate Lando Norris, who claimed second. […]
